About D.K. Bull

D.K. Bull is a scholar working on Civil and Structural Engineering, Building and Construction, Mechanical Engineering, Mechanics of Materials and Control and Systems Engineering, having authored 53 papers that have together received 767 indexed citations. Recurring topics across this work include Seismic Performance and Analysis (34 papers), Structural Behavior of Reinforced Concrete (33 papers), Structural Response to Dynamic Loads (17 papers), Masonry and Concrete Structural Analysis (17 papers), Structural Load-Bearing Analysis (13 papers), Structural Engineering and Vibration Analysis (10 papers), Concrete Corrosion and Durability (7 papers) and Structural Analysis of Composite Materials (5 papers). The work is most often cited by research in Civil and Structural Engineering (716 citations), Building and Construction (427 citations), Control and Systems Engineering (57 citations), Statistics, Probability and Uncertainty (11 citations) and Earth-Surface Processes (9 citations). D.K. Bull has collaborated with scholars based in New Zealand, China and United States. Frequent co-authors include Stefano Pampanin, Rajesh P. Dhakal, Alessandro Palermo, D. Marriott, Athol J. Carr, Gregory Cole, Robert Park, R. C. Fenwick, G. H. McVerry and Tam Larkin. Their work appears in journals such as Bulletin of the New Zealand Society for Earthquake Engineering, ACI Structural Journal, Journal of Earthquake Engineering, Journal of Advanced Concrete Technology and Journal of Constructional Steel Research.
